The future is here: Self-driving cars are on the streets, an algorithm gives you movie and TV recommendations, IBM's Watson triumphed on Jeopardy over puny human brains, computer programs can be trained to play Atari games. But how do all these things work?


Smart machines are no longer science-fiction. They are being used by businesses right here and now. And, every day, their capabilities are growing.
So exactly what is a smart machine?

    The human brain is a marvel. A mere 20 watts of energy are required to power the 22 billion neurons in a brain that is roughly the size of a grapefruit. To field a conventional computer with comparable cognitive capacity would require gigawatts of electricity and a machine the size of a football field. 

    ― John E. Kelly III, smart Machines: IBM's Watson and the Era of Cognitive Computing
